Results of MPSC State Service Mains Announced: View Now!

In total 130 candidates qualified in the state services exam conducted by the Maharashtra Public Service Commission (MPSC)

By Malavikka

The Maharashtra Public Service Commission (MPSC) has declared the result of State Service Mains examination on Thursday. In total 130 candidates qualifed in the exam. The results for those candidates who had appeared for the exam will be available at the official website www.mpsc.gov.in.

When was the exam held?

The exam was conducted in two parts, prelims and mains. The prelims were conducted in April 2016 followed by the mains in September 2016. In boys category, Bhushan Ahire from Nashik, has topped the exam and in girls category, Poonam Patil has topped with a total score of 507 points.

Sub-Collector through MPSC

According to available reports, a recommendation of total of five candidates have been made by the MPSC for the post of sub-collector. Besides Ahire, Shrikant Gaikwad, Sanjay Kumar Davle, Bhasake Sandeep, Neelam Bafna have been selected for the post of sub-collector.

How to check the MPSC result

  • Visit the official website www.mpsc.gov.in
  • Click on the 'results' tab under 'competitive examination'
  • Click on the link 'State Services Main Examination - 2016- Final Result'
  • A PDF file will open containing the details such as roll number, name, category, marks and recommendation remark of the candidate
  • Save it to your computer and take a printout for future reference

Why was the MPSC exam held?

The examination was conducted to fill all vacant posts in the A and B group across the state which includes the police, administration and finance departments.

Vacancies to be filled

  • Deputy collector
  • Deputy superintendent of police/assistant commissioner of police,
  • Assistant commissioner of sales tax
  • Deputy chief executive officer/block development officer
  • Assistant director - Maharashtra Finance and Account Service
  • Chief officer- municipal corporation/Municipal Parishad, Tahsildar
  • Deputy education officer in the state government
